This page will track public information on major OpenOffice.org deployments. To add to it, include a URL or reference information of the deployment.

Schools and Universities

  • Noxon Schools in Montana, USA: 185 desktops moved to OpenOffice in December 2005. (60 run OOo on Windows, 125 on Linux.)
  • Earlham College, a Quaker college in Richmond, Indiana, upgraded all of its public computers to OpenOffice at the beginning of 2005.
  • Handsworth Grammar School, Birmingham, UK - runs a GNU/Linux Thin Client network with OpenOffice as standard - since 2003.
  • Ilford Preparatory School, London, UK - runs a Windows network with Open Office as the primary office suite.
  • Bacone College in Oklahoma.
  • SUNY Albany: ResNet, the campus IT services group, provides incoming students with the ResNet Software Suite CD, which includes Firefox, Thunderbird, OpenOffice.org, anti-spyware and anti-virus applications.
  • University of Detroit Jesuit High School and Academy: 268 desktops in summer 2003.
  • Public Schools in Portland, Oregon, USA
  • Swadelands School in Kent UK
  • High Schools in Chile, via Enlaces
  • Mall School for boys in Richmond, UK
  • The US State of Indiana will deploy up to 300,000 Linspire Linux computers with OpenOffice.org over the next few years: Linspire press release.
  • University of Melbourne, Australia Distributes OpenOffice CDs to students for free or a minimal charge.
  • University of the Philippines.
  • Parshvanath College of Engineering, Thane, India: "Today, we have over 2,500 users on our network... Using OpenOffice.org, we have saved roughly Rs 70,000."
  • The Portuguese Ministry of Education has installed 15,000 PCs in 1,000 schools with Linux and OpenOffice.org following an agreement with Sun Microsystems.
  • The Hayesbrook School in Tonbridge, Kent, UK - Deployed OpenOffice 2 to over 400 Desktops & Laptops.
  • Asia School of Arts and Sciences, Philippines. Will start implementing OpenOffice.org beginning schoolyear 2006-07.
  • Glenwood School for Boys and Girls, Glenwood, IL, USA: Migrated to OpenOffice.org 2 on over 100 desktops in our Grades 2-8 school in September 2005 (started with beta release), replacing MS Office 2000. Distributed 100 installation CDs to students to take home in December 2005. Have deployed OpenOffice or StarOffice to every computer on our campus, approximately 200 desktops in all. While MS Office is still used by many staff members, this was our first year to use OpenOffice exclusively for our students in the academic program.
